Transaction dd1161d6012b23c0c8ae7c8e36f2f8c93b352ff445f775637df8a10d6211cde8
1 Input
2 Outputs
- dd1161d6012b23c0c8ae7c8e36f2f8c93b352ff445f775637df8a10d6211cde8:0
- dd1161d6012b23c0c8ae7c8e36f2f8c93b352ff445f775637df8a10d6211cde8:1
value 900000
address 1PisRRhTPxV83cG3pCiLMRYCK4F4hETizS
value 50955134
address 16XBydaB1tNo35raenURQZWxZZw9b5w4fq